Default can Xadago and mucuna be taken together?

First, apologies for cross-posting this on HealthUnlocked and Neurotalk.

Does anyone know whether it is safe to take mucuna powder and Xadago at the same time? Or if not at the exact same moment, to be on both substances at the same time (eg taking Xadago once per day and taking mucuna a few times per day?)

My mother supplements her Sinemet with mucuna. Her understanding is that mucuna and Azilect are not to be mixed. Since Xadago and Azilect are both MAO-B inhibitors, we are wondering if the same caution would be extended to using Xadago and mucuna at the same time.

She has been prescribed Xadago and would like to start it, but we wanted to make sure it is safe first. Unfortunately here MDS is not always the most helpful when it comes to combining pharmaceuticals with other substances.

I don't know about Xadago, but mucuna is definitely compatible with Azilect.
I would be worried if Xadago is compatible with Azilect because they are both MAO inhibitors.
